Concrete fo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ically include identifying cracks, settling, or shifting in the foundation, and then employing methods such as underpinning, mudjacking, or piering to stabilize and reinforce the structure. The goal is to restore the foundation’s integrity, prevent further damage, and ensure the safety of the building.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ques and equipment to evaluate the extent of damage and implement appropriate solutions tailored to each property’s needs.

Foundation Repair Cost - Typical expenses for concrete foundation repair range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age. For example, minor cracks might cost around $2,500, while extensive underpinning could reach $6,500 or more.
Average Pricing Factors - Costs vary based on the size of the foundation and the repair method used. Smaller repairs in residential properties may be closer to $3,000, whereas larger commercial projects can exceed $10,000.
Material and Labor Costs - The price range reflects both material costs and labor, with typical expenses falling between $1,500 and $5,500 for standard repairs. Complex issues requiring specialized techniques tend to be at the higher end of the spectrum.
Regional Price Variations - Prices for concrete foundation repair services can differ across locations like New Baden, IL, and nearby areas. Local pros provide estimates that account for regional material costs and labor rates, which influence overall expenses.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around door frames.
How long does concrete fo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but repairs can often be completed within a few days to a week.
What causes foundation problems in residential properties? Causes can include soil settlement, water damage, poor drainage, or natural shifting of the ground beneath the foundation.
Are there different types of foundation repair methods? Yes, options include underpinning, mudjacking, piering, and slabjacking, selected based on the specific foundation condition.
